Enhancing Personalized Learning

AI algorithms analyze individual student data to tailor educational experiences. By assessing learning patterns, preferences, and progress, AI delivers content that matches each student’s needs. For example, adaptive learning platforms like DreamBox and Knewton offer customized lessons, ensuring students grasp concepts before moving forward.

Improving Accessibility

AI-driven tools break down barriers to education. Speech-to-text technologies support students with disabilities, enabling easy note-taking and comprehension. AI-powered language translation software, such as Microsoft Translator, allows non-native speakers to access learning materials in their preferred language. Hence, AI ensures that all students receive quality education regardless of their circumstances.

Streamlining Administrative Tasks

AI simplifies complex administrative duties. Routine tasks, like attendance tracking or grade recording, now require minimal effort. Tools such as facial recognition systems track attendance accurately. Machine learning algorithms handle grading with precision, ensuring fair evaluation. This automation enables teachers to focus more on instructional activities and student interaction.

Tailoring Educational Material

AI tailors educational content by analyzing vast amounts of student data. It identifies individual strengths and weaknesses, suggesting customized materials that optimize learning outcomes. For instance, platforms like Smart Sparrow and Knewton create adaptive learning paths, helping students grasp complex subjects at their own pace. This approach ensures no student is left behind, improving overall academic performance.

Addressing Ethical Concerns

Ethical concerns arise in AI’s application in education. Algorithms might inadvertently reinforce biases if the training data isn’t diverse. It’s critical to ensure that AI systems promote inclusivity and fairness. Implementing transparent AI processes can aid in identifying and mitigating these biases. Educational institutions should regularly assess their AI tools to ensure ethical compliance.

Ensuring Data Privacy

Student data privacy presents another significant challenge. AI relies heavily on data to function effectively, but this raises concerns about the security of sensitive student information. To protect data, educational institutions must follow stringent data privacy regulations like GDPR and FERPA. Encrypting data and using secure storage solutions can further safeguard student information, ensuring trust in AI systems.
